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Church & Oswaldtwistle to Apperley Bridge start from £18.70 one way, or £18.80 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Church & Oswaldtwistle to Apperley Bridge are available for £20.80 one way, or £22.20 return

Station Facilities and Amenities

Church & Oswaldtwistle station doesn't have a staffed ticket office, but you're not left in the lurch. Ticket machines are on hand for collecting tickets purchased online, but do note that they aren't accessible for everyone. Assistance at the station is limited, but help can be requested by using the customer help points available or by reaching out via their helpline. Passenger safety is prioritized with CCTV in operation throughout the station. There are seating areas at the station to cater to waiting passengers, though there are no waiting rooms available.

Fully equipped for the basics, the station lacks certain facilities—you won't find any refreshment stalls, ATMs, or shops. Therefore, it's best to prepare ahead before arriving. There are also no toilets, baby-changing facilities, or car parks available. However, for those interested in cycling, keep in mind that there’s no bike storage at this station as well.

Passenger Accessibility

Accessibility is a key concern at Church & Oswaldtwistle. While step-free access is possible on one side via a lengthy ramp, accessing the other platform requires navigating steps. If mobility assistance is needed, you might want to tap into the national Passenger Assist service before your journey. While the station might not be the most equipped in terms of accessibility, ramps are available for train access. Further information can be found by checking out the station's 360-degree map.

Station Details & Facilities

At Apperley Bridge, ticket purchasing is streamlined albeit straightforward. While there's no traditional ticket office, ticket machines are conveniently available at the station for both purchases and collections. However, keep in mind that these machines are not accessible. The presence of an induction loop compensates for this by aiding those with hearing impairments. As a Category A station, Apperley Bridge ensures step-free access throughout, making navigation easier for all, despite the absence of tactile pavings.

While facilities like luggage storage, waiting rooms, and even a basic seating arrangement are lacking, the station is under the constant watch of CCTV, providing a secure environment for passengers. It's also worth mentioning that you won't find toilets or refreshment options here, so plan accordingly. Parking is available with 98 standard and 6 accessible spaces, and the good news is—parking here is free!

Getting There and Moving Forward

Transport links to and from Apperley Bridge are designed with convenience in mind, despite the station's understated facilities. For those times when the train service isn't running, the rail replacement service operates efficiently with a turning circle located at the far end of the car park.
